Mel King, whose work helped shape the city of Boston, has died. He was 94. King’s decades-long career included directing the New Urban League of Greater Boston, serving as a state representative beginning in the 1970’s, and teaching at MIT’s Department of Urban Studies.

Redlining maps document the history of institutional racism in the United States. They also reveal how the government managed risk for capital—a role that has perpetuated inequality long after the end of explicit discrimination in the housing market. dissentmagazine.org/online_a…
